Navigation Menu+

Look Click Print, Inc.

Posted in eCommerce, Featured, HTML, Portfolio, Website

Look Click Print, Inc.

Fine Art Giclée Reproductions of the World’s Finest Artwork from Museums all over the world.  State of the art reproductions making enjoying art affordable to the masses.  Various kiosks are placed around the world and are controlled via one central point.

Pin It on Pinterest

Share This

Share this post with your friends!